摘要
By means of this study We have optimized the performance of the cryptographic algorithm Rijndael in a low cost hardware/software system, in a FPGA Spartan3e board of Xilinx with a MicroBlaze soft-processor. After the study of its execution in six systems with different configurations, the hardware bits rotation of MicroBlaze's optimizes the process of coding and deciphered, and the combination with the implementation of a coprocesador with a Galois field multiplier optimizes the key expansion.
